Abstract
Electrodeposition method has allowed the preparation of submicron CoPt particles covered with CoNi shells of different thicknesses. The magnetic properties of these particles have been analysed; a contribution of semi-hard magnetic behaviour and soft-magnetic behaviour, associated with the particles, and the CoNi shell, respectively, has been detected. Although a gradual decrease of the coercivity was observed by increasing the CoNi shell thickness, the CoPt core always dominates the magnetization–magnetic field curve shape.
